DESCRIPTION
The LM2700 is a step-up DC/DC converter with a 3.6A, 80mΩ internal switch and pin selectable operating frequency. With the ability to produce 500m A at 8V from a single Lithium Ion battery, the LM2700 is an ideal part for biasing LCD displays. The LM2700 can be operated at switching frequencies of 600k Hz and 1.25MHz allowing for easy filtering and low noise. An external pensation pin gives the user flexibility in setting frequency pensation, which makes possible the use of small, low ESR ceramic capacitors at the output. The LM2700 Features continuous switching at light loads and operates with a switching quiescent current of 2.0m A at 600k Hz and 3.0m A at 1.25MHz. The LM2700 is available in a low profile 14-lead TSSOP package or a 14-lead WSON package.
